Collectors Summary

Color bräunlich, oliv-grau
Streak color schwarz
Lustre Metallglanz
Hardness (Mohs) 8 - 9
Solubility ++ HNO3, - HCl
Crystal System trigonal, R3c

Chemism

Chemical formula

V2O3

Additional chem. information

Lt. Strunz 9. Edition: auch zugehörig zur Hämatit Serie

Chemical composition

Sauerstoff, Vanadium

Unit weight: 149.88131 u; Number of atoms in the formula: 5
